On December 14, 1900, Max Planck reluctantly presented to the German Physical Society meeting in Berlin his discoveries about an obscure physical phenomenon known as black body radiation. His hesitation came from an awareness that his findings were totally contrary to the accepted notions of the nature of matter. Moreover, these notions were very dearly held, for they were widely viewed as a triumph of logic and reason – a means to understand all of nature. At the time of Planck’s lecture, all matter was viewed as composed of “billiard ball” atoms moving about predictably according to the laws of motion developed by Sir Isaac Newton. Lord Rutherford summarized the physicist’s self-confidence by stating that all of science was divided into two branches: physics and stamp collecting. Newton’s mechanics had led to an industrial revolution that offered much hope and enthusiasm for the future of technology.  Max Planck’s upsetting presentation led to the birth of quantum physics, and the end of an era of comfort in which physicists knew with great confidence they had the means to fathom all of the mysteries of nature. The universe had come to be predictable as a “clockworks” and the human body could be viewed an intricate machine made of parts that could be understood and fixed if necessary.

Quantum physics led to an entirely different worldview, in which the atom, its parts, and all things made of atoms including living things were better viewed as relationships rather than as isolated things. Electrons are no longer viewed as particles orbiting the atomic nucleus like the planets orbit the sun, but more as energetic essences with sizes and boundaries that can only be approximated.

What Is Contemporary Stress?

A response to stress expresses itself as resistance, tension, strain, or frustration that throws off our equilibrium, keeping us out of sync. Two people in identical circumstances may respond in very different ways (e.g., one gets stressed, the other inspired) depending upon how they perceive the situation.

What contributes to contemporary stress? We have always had earthquakes, hurricanes, and floods, but the increasing volume and severity of these events has become alarming. Weather devastation generates economic stress in skyrocketing prices for gasoline, heating fuel, and food. Epidemics of influenza and other infectious diseases aren’t new, but drug-resistant strains of virulent organisms are new and threatening. The history of humankind is full of examples of conflicts, wars, and acts of terrorism. However, never before has there been such a great threat of death and potential mass destruction due to terrorist acts as there is now.

The public is understandably stressed by constant reminders from the media that any of these contemporary stressors could easily affect you or a loved one at any time. It is therefore not surprising that 8 or 9 out of every 10 visits to primary care physicians are for stress-related complaints. The World Health Organization estimated that by 2020, clinical depression will outrank cancer and follow only heart disease as the second leading cause of disability in the world. Is it because contemporary stress is somehow different and more dangerous? What people want to know is what they can do about any of this. How can they learn to avoid and cope with this avalanche of stress that seems to surround today’s world?

Stress is often misunderstood. Many people look at outside events as the source of stress, but, in fact, the experience of stress is actually caused by our emotional reactions to events. We can break the vicious stress cycle by taking a proactive role in managing our reactions. Actively self-generating positive emotions when you start to react can favorably affect your physiological and psychological processes. Positive emotions help shift stress-producing perceptions, counterbalance the effects of stress reactions, and promote regeneration at both the psychological and physiological levels (see Science of the Heart). As you gain increased management of emotions, the experience of stress then truly becomes more a choice than an automatic reaction. In learning to address and transform stress from within, you become an active contributor to your own health, balance, and fulfillment.

One of the most underestimated fruits is probably the kiwi. Small, green, and squishy in texture, it is not usually on a person’s mind when they think of grabbing a piece of fruit. An exotic berry from the vine plant Actinidia deliciosa, the kiwifruit’s fuzzy outer surface protects the delicious inside from external forces before it is ready to enjoy.

Originally called the Chinese Gooseberry, to market the fruit more globally, it was renamed “melonette” in the 1950s and then to “kiwifruit” by exporters in New Zealand. A kiwi is the national bird of New Zealand and people from the country are also called “Kiwis,” so in order to alleviate any confusion, kiwifruit is not abbreviated in New Zealand, but most everywhere else the fruit is shortened and known simply as kiwi.

Rutgers University recently conducted a study of the 27 most popular fruits—although I do not think I can name that many types of fruit off the top of my head—and named kiwi the “most nutritionally dense” among all of them. The kiwi, with its tangy, saliva-inducing taste, gives you a day’s worth of vitamin C, blood-pressure helping potassium, the antioxidant-rich vitamin E, and lutein, which helps promote good vision. Calorie-counting alert: a kiwi carries only 50 calories and doesn’t involve any muss or fuss to eat. Slice kiwis on top of a fruit tart and bake, layer them in a yogurt parfait or on top of pancakes, or simply slice and spoon into your mouth to enjoy its best benefits.

With more fiber than apples and twice the amount of vitamin C as an orange, (minus the seeds, rind, and pulp that tend to get in the way), kiwi also helps reduce damage from free radicals which can lead to long term diseases like cancer later in life.
